Why These Are the Top Cabinet Installers Contractors in Lacey

The cabinet installer market in Lacey and the greater Olympia area is moderately competitive, characterized by a mix of specialized custom cabinet shops and versatile handyman services. The overall quality is high, with several long-standing businesses earning excellent reputations for craftsmanship. Homeowners have clear options: specialized craftsmen for high-end, fully custom projects (like Cabinet Masters and Olympic Custom Cabinets) and general repair services for standard installations and smaller jobs (like Mr. Handyman). Pricing reflects this division, with basic installation or refacing starting in the $1,500 - $3,000 range, while full custom kitchen cabinet projects typically range from $10,000 to $25,000+. A key factor for consumers is that many of the most reputable providers are based in adjacent Olympia but actively serve the Lacey market, providing a strong pool of qualified contractors to choose from.

1What is the typical cost range for professional cabinet installation in Lacey, WA?

In the Lacey/Olympia area, professional cabinet installation typically ranges from $100 to $250 per linear foot, with the final cost heavily dependent on cabinet quality, project complexity, and any structural modifications needed. For a standard kitchen, homeowners can expect a total labor cost between $2,000 and $5,000. It's wise to get multiple quotes, as regional material costs and the competitive local contractor market can create variance.

2How does Western Washington's humid climate affect cabinet installation and material choice?

Our damp climate, especially from fall through spring, makes controlling indoor humidity critical. We recommend choosing moisture-resistant materials like plywood boxes over particleboard and ensuring finishes are properly sealed. During installation, it's crucial to let cabinets acclimate to your home's interior for at least 48-72 hours to prevent warping or joint separation after installation.

3Do I need a permit for cabinet installation in Lacey, and what local regulations should I know about?

A simple like-for-like cabinet replacement typically doesn't require a permit in Lacey. However, if your project involves moving plumbing, electrical, or altering load-bearing walls, you will likely need permits from the City of Lacey Community Development Department. Always verify with your installer, as they should be familiar with Thurston County's specific codes, especially regarding plumbing clearances and ventilation.

4What should I look for when choosing a cabinet installer in the Lacey area?

Prioritize local installers with strong references and verifiable proof of insurance and bonding, as required by Washington state law. Look for experience with the specific cabinet brands or types you've selected (e.g., custom, semi-custom, or RTA). A reputable Lacey installer will also provide a detailed written contract and be knowledgeable about scheduling around local factors like the busy summer renovation season.

5What is a realistic timeline for a kitchen cabinet installation project in my Lacey home?

For a standard kitchen, the physical installation usually takes 2-4 days for a skilled crew, assuming all cabinets and materials are on-site. However, the total project timeline must account for the ordering and shipping lead times (often 6-12 weeks for custom cabinets) and potential delays during our wet season for deliveries. Planning for a buffer and scheduling during drier months (late spring to early fall) can lead to a smoother process.
